Description
Delicious chocolate peanut butter bark that is easy to make and perfect for sharing!
Ingredients
Scale
- 5 cups Chocolate (Semisweet, Melted)
- 2–3 tbsp Peanut butter (Creamy, Melted)
- 15–20 Saltine crackers (E. Salted crackers)
- 2 tsp Sprinkles
Instructions
- Line the cookie tray or cake pan with parchment paper.
- Pour about 2 cups of melted chocolate in the center.
- Use a spatula to spread the chocolate over the entire pan.
- Arrange a layer of salted crackers on top of the chocolate.
- Pour 3 more cups of melted chocolate in the center.
- Use a spatula to spread the chocolate completely over the crackers.
- Drop spoonfuls of melted peanut butter randomly on top of the chocolate.
- Run a wooden skewer or chopstick through the melted chocolate until you have lots of swirls and a beautiful swirled or marble effect.
- Toss some sprinkles.
- Place pan in the fridge for 20-30 minutes to allow the chocolate and peanut butter to set and harden.
- Flip the pan onto a table and remove the parchment paper and break the bark into random pieces. You can also use a knife to cut random shapes and enjoy!
